oa开发软件系统
更新时间:2023-03-12
OA(Office Automation)系统是一种整合了计算机技术和管理思想的办公自动化系统,可以实现信息管理、自动流程处理等功能。由于办公自动化可以提高办公效率、降低工作强度和精力,OA软件正在被越来越多的企业和组织采用。
在进行OA软件开发的过程中,一般会分为以下几个步骤:分析系统需求,确定系统功能并设计系统架构,选择OA软件开发工具和开发平台,编写程序,调试系统,完成系统功能,部署系统,以及运行系统维护和更新等。从这几个环节可以看出,OA软件系统的开发需要专业知识和技术,因此很多公司和组织都会选择外包OA软件开发或找专业的OA软件公司来完成。
OA管理软件系统是OA办公软件系统中非常重要的一部分,能够为企业提供全面的OA办公流程管理和规范化管理。通过OA管理软件系统,企业可以有效的规范化管理办公流程,明确部门工作的职能范围和职责,规范每一个细节,有效完成部门间的沟通和协调,实现企业改进和发展。
对于简单OA系统开发而言,很多公司选择使用面向业务模块的开源软件,如B/S和C/S架构的OA系统模版和开源模块,可以实现系统的简单快速开发。而对于比较复杂的OA系统,则需要有系统分析和开发过程方面的专业知识,可以根据企业的实际情况,借助开发工具进行开发。
另外,一些开放源代码OA系统也可以成为一种选择,这些开放源代码OA系统可以在开发者自行贡献代码和自定义功能的基础上,灵活地实现自己的开发需求。
总之,开发OA系统需要专业知识和技术,企业可以根据自己的实际情况,选择外包、找OA软件公司、使用开源模板以及开放源代码OA系统等途径进行开发,灵活高效的实现OA系统的功能及应用。